The 117 team of MBA Football opened up their season with a 21-16 road victory over Hewitt Trussville in Birmingham Alabama. After falling behind 7-0, MBA was able to answer as senior quarterback Glenn Coleman connected with senior tight end Jordan Wilson on a 19 yard strike to tie the score at 7 in the second quarter. With two minutes to go in the second half, Coleman hit junior receiver Montgomery Owen with a 69 yard pass play that would allow MBA to take a 14-13 lead. It was a lead that MBA would take to halftime thanks to the Big Red defense blocking a Hewitt Trussville field goal attempt.
In the second half, both defenses proved to be stout as the teams exchanged multiple possessions. Finally, with four minutes remaining in the game HT was able to take the lead 16-14 with a short field goal. The Big Red offense was no time as they were able to retake the lead with a two play scoring drive of their own. On the first play of the drive Coleman connected with sophomore receiver Clint Blackwell on a 48 yard pass play. Junior tailback Ty Chandler, who rushed for 127 yards on the night, capped the scoring drive with a 25 yard touchdown run. On the final drive of the game, Hewitt Trussville drove the ball deep into Big Red territory, but senior captain David Gaw was able to corral an interception and seal the victory for Team 117.
